Route 66
Level 3 - mostly relaxed travel with light walking at historic sites, museums, and roadside attractions, plus some optional exploring in towns and cities.
Tour Itinerary
Day 1 – Welcome Dinner
Begin your journey on the legendary “Mother Road.” Travel to Chicago, where Route 66 begins, and enjoy a Welcome Dinner at a classic Route 66 restaurant. (D)
Day 2 – Chicago to Springfield
Start at the “Begin Route 66” sign and travel original stretches of the Mother Road. Visit restored gas stations, the Route 66 Hall of Fame, and the elegant Davis Mansion. In Springfield, explore Lincoln history or more Route 66 sites. Dinner on your own, with the option to join the group at the Cozy Dog Drive-In. (B)
Day 3 – Springfield to St. Louis
Visit quirky roadside icons including the world’s largest ketchup bottle and the Dixie Family Restaurant. Stop at Motorheads and the Litchfield Museum before arriving in St. Louis. Dinner includes a sweet stop at Ted Drewes Frozen Custard. (B, D)
Day 4 – St. Louis to Joplin
Head through the Ozarks, stopping at the Mule Trading Post, the giant rocking chair, and Meramec Caverns. Experience the historic 66 Drive-In Theater before settling in Joplin. (B, L)
Day 5 – Joplin to Oklahoma City
Step into nostalgia at Riverton Nelson Old Store, then visit Pops Soda Shop with its rainbow wall of sodas. Stop at the OKC Mustang Car Show before checking into your Bricktown hotel. Dinner included. (B, D)
Day 6 – Oklahoma to Amarillo
Tour the Route 66 Museum, visit the art-deco U Drop Inn Café, and see the Leaning Tower of Texas. End with a lively dinner at the Big Texan Steak Ranch. (B, D)
Day 7 – Amarillo to Albuquerque
Stop at Cadillac Ranch and the Glenrio ghost town before continuing to Santa Fe to explore Native American art and adobe architecture. Arrive in Albuquerque for dinner overlooking the Sandia Mountains. (B, D)
Day 8 – Great Sand Dunes National Park
Though Route 66 ends in Albuquerque, continue north to Colorado. Visit Great Sand Dunes National Park before reaching Lonetree, south of Denver, for a Farewell Dinner. (B, D)
Day 9 – Golden Spike Tower & Home
Stop at the Union Pacific Railyard and Golden Spike Tower to see the world’s largest rail yard. Return home with memories of the first half of your Route 66 adventure. Part Two continues to Los Angeles in 2026. (B)
